Adhere a panel of Plaid Tidings 6″ x 6″ designer series paper to the front of an Early Espresso Card base (don’t forget that the Plaid Tidings DSP is on sale this month! 😊). Stamp the Birch cling background stamp in Early Espresso ink on a Bumblebee panel and emboss it with the Tasteful Textile 3D embossing folder. Adhere it to an Early Espresso mat and pop it on the card front with dimensionals.

Adhere a berry branch from the Forever Gold Laser cut specialty paper to the embossed panel. Cut the Gathered Leaves dies from Cajun Craze, Pumpkin Pie and Pear Pizzazz card stock. Adhere the leaves to the card front. Stamp three small daisies from the Stampin’ Up! Daisy Lane stamp set in Bumblebee ink on Bumblebee card stock. Sponge the centers with Cajun Craze ink and sponge Pumpkin Pie ink around the petals, leaving just the tips. Punch out the three petal clusters with the medium daisy punch. Gently bend the petals back on one cluster, back and forward on the second and all forward on the last cluster. Adhere the clusters together with liquid glue.

Cut the center from gold foil using the flower center die from the Poinsettias Dies and adhere it to the middle of the flower. Pop the flower on the card front with a dimensional. Adhere a gold trim bow under the flower. Stamp the sentiment from the Stampin’ Up! Daisy Lane stamp set in Early Espresso ink on a strip of Pumpkin Pie and trim the ends. Adhere it to a strip of early Espresso and pop it on the card front with dimensionals. Finish the card front with three Gilded Gems.

Stamp and emboss a strip of Bumblebee card stock to match the front panel and adhere it to the bottom of a Whisper White panel. Cut a small Gathered Leaves Die leaf from Pumpkin Pie and adhere it to the top corner of the card.

Cardstock Cuts for this project:
- Early Espresso – 4-1/4″ x 11″ card base scored at 5-1/2″, 3/8″ x 2-1/2″ (label mat), 2-5/8″ x 5-1/8″ (embossed panel mat)
- Bumblebee – 2-1/2″ x 5″ (embossed front panel), 1/4″ x 4″ (embossed inside trim), 2″ x 6″ (stamped and punched daisy clusters)
- Cajun Craze – 2″ x 2″ (large die cut leaf)
- Pumpkin Pie – 2″ x 3-1/2″ (medium and small die cut leaves), 1/4″ x 3-1/2″ (label)
- Pear Pizzazz – 1-1/2″ x 1-1/2″ (small die cut leaf)
- Gold Foil – 1″ x 1″ (flower center)
- Whisper White – 4″ x 5-1/4″ (inside panel), 3-7/8″ x 5-1/8″ (front mat), 3/4″ x 6″ (die cut sprigs), 1-1/2″ x 2-1/2″ (punched label)
- Plaid Tidings DSP – 3-1/4″ x 4-1/4″ (front background)
